Xbox has announced five new additions for Game Pass in October, including titles that transition to the Standard tier and some that will leave the service.
Among the newcomers are a baseball simulator and a narrative game that are already present in the Ultimate and PC tiers, now available in the Standard tier.
Mad Streets, a chaotic physics-based party brawler, will join Game Pass on October 7, appealing to players who enjoy multiplayer mayhem and unique gameplay.
Inscryption, a notable horror-themed roguelike deck-builder considered one of the best current horror games, will be available on Game Pass starting October 10.
